  1. A+ Certification Training

    • Continuing Education

    The A+ Certification Training program focuses on microcomputers and required software components used in today’s technology environments. Students learn topics including site preparation, installation procedures, components, power supplies, modems, printers, switches, operating systems, help and security systems, packaged programs, utilities, languages, and operating procedures. The program also prepares students for the A+ Certification exam.

  9. Computer Numerical Control Operator (CNC Operator)

    • Continuing Education

    The Computer Numerical Control (CNC) Operator program prepares students to safely and accurately operate CNC machines used in modern manufacturing. Students learn to load and run CNC programs, set up machines with raw materials, and verify program accuracy before production begins. The program also emphasizes quality control by teaching students how to inspect finished parts to ensure they meet required specifications and standards.

  14. Insurance Specialist

    • Workforce Training

    The Insurance Specialist program area introduces students to business loss exposures and the operation of insurance policies related to property, business income, crime, marine, auto, and government programs. Students develop foundational knowledge of insurance concepts and may be prepared to take the licensing exam sponsored by the Department of Insurance.
